When I first got Yuna, she had diarrhea constantly for a few days. I didn't know what was going on. I got a stool sample to my vet and the results came back that she had Giardia, I am not sure if this applies to you since your little girl had kidney failures before. Yuna got medicine for her giardia and everything was fine after... In my opinion, I wouldn't wait any more days... bring sample to the vet in a ziplock bag if you have to and make sure its fresh. |

She should be seen at the vet asap. These little ones can go downhill pretty quickly:( Until you can get to the vet, you might try feeding her a teaspoon of plain canned pumpkin. Any time diarrhea goes on for more than a day, they need medical attention. I hope your darling feels better soon!!! |
